Skin Lightening Efficacy of New Formulations Enhanced by Chitin Nanoparticles Delivery System. Note Ⅰ

摘要

This preliminary study reports the whitening efficacy obtained in vivo by the contemporary topical use of 3 cosmetic emulsions enriched with the designed nanoparticles and applied for a period of 6 months on the skin of 40 voluntary subjects, female and male, affected by hyperpigmentation in different skin areas. Before the skin treatment, different Chitin Nanofibril-Hyaluronan (CN-HA) block copolymeric nanoparticles, entrapping known whitening agents, were controlled in vitro to verify their activity on the melanogenetic process. It was controlled in vitro their antioxidant and anti-inflammatory activity together with the possibility to interfere on melanin synthesis and melanosome transfer. From the obtained results it has been shown that the combined activity of different whitening agents entrapped into natural nanoparticles as carrier, gives as result an interesting depigmenting effectiveness without any side effect. A new study is in progress to confirm these data.
